Georgia Nut Co Recalls 76,121 Cases of tru fru Creme Freeze-Dried Strawberries 3.4 oz (2025)

Georgia Nut Co recalls 76,121 cases of tru fru Strawberries + Creme Freeze-Dried Fresh 3.4 oz pouches sold nationwide at retailers including Albertsons, CVS, Food Lion, H-E-B, Kroger, Target, Stew Leonard's and more. A potential for metal fragments in some packages is the hazard. Consumers should stop using the product and contact Georgia Nut Co for a refund or replacement.

About This Product

tru fru Strawberries + Creme Freeze-Dried Fresh are 3.4 oz fruit snack pouches. The product is marketed as a convenient freeze-dried fruit snack.

Why This Is Dangerous

A metal fragment hazard exists in some packages. If present, metal could cause mouth injury or be a choking hazard.

Product Details

- Product: tru fru Strawberries + Creme Freeze-Dried Fresh, 3.4 oz pouch - UPC: 850048358249 - Case pack: 6 retail units per case - Recalled quantity: 76,121 cases - Sold at: Albertsons, CVS, Food Lion, H-E-B, Hungryroot, Ingles Markets, Kroger, Stew Leonard's, Target and online retailers - Distribution: United States - Price: Unknown

Reported Incidents

No injuries or incidents have been reported.
